BRIDGEPORT, Pa. — The 2025 USA Water Polo Division III Women’s Collegiate Water Polo National Championship will take place on Saturday-Sunday, May 3-4, at Division III No. 7-ranked/Collegiate Water Polo Association (CWPA) Division III Champion Augustana College’s Anne Greve Lund Natatorium in Rock Island, Ill.  It marks the second championship in less than a month at Augustana as the Vikings hosted and won the CWPA Division III Championship tournament on Friday-Sunday, April 11-13.

A championship pitting the top two finishing teams from the CWPA versus the anticipated Southern California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(SCIAC) champion and runner-up, the event will be contested for the fourth time in 2025 with prior championships at Pomona-Pitzer (2022, 2024) and Augsutana (2023).  The championship was slated to begin in 2021 but was eliminated as only a portion of the National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A) Division III institutions elected to field teams due to the COVID-19 outbreak.

Augustana – which defeated Washington & Jefferson College by a 10-7 score on April 13 for the program’s third consecutive CWPA Division Championship (2023, 2024, 2025) – will make the program’s fourth appearance in the fourth year of the USAWP Division III Championship with its inaugural appearance in 2022 coming as the CWPA runner-up.  Following the cancellation of the 2021 event due to the outbreak of COVID-19, the Vikings qualified in 2022 (at Pomona-Pitzer Colleges, Fourth Place), 2023 (at Augustana, Third Place) and 2024 (at Pomona-Pitzer, Third Place) along with Austin College (2022 – Third Place; 2023 – Fourth Place; 2024 – Fourth Place).

W&J earns the program’s inaugural trip to either the man’s and/or women’s USA Division III Championship to become the sixth institution to earn a berth to the women’s event by joining Augustana (2022, 2023, 2024, 2025), Austin (2022, 2023, 2024), three-time champion Pomona-Pitzer (2022, 2023, 2024), Claremont-Mudd-Scripps Colleges (2023, 2024) and Whittier College (2022). 

In the history of the women’s championship, Pomona-Pitzer (2022 – 1st; 2023 – 1st; 2024 – 1st), Whittier (2022 – 2nd) and Claremont-Mudd-Scripps (2023 – 2nd, 2024 – 2nd) have made the title game, while Austin (2022 – 3rd ; 2023- 4th; 2024 – 4th) and Augustana (2022 – 4th ; 2023 – 3rd; 2024 – 3rd) have contested the Third Place game each year.
